ERO assessed Lollipops Grey Lynn as Not well placed in 2017. Our analysis of the ERO report identified strengths in children's wellbeing, whānau partnership, and health and safety (all grade B), but identified areas requiring development in curriculum and learning, bicultural practice, and leadership and governance (all grade C).
